Roy.Li edd8d59771 site/common-linux: move ac_cv_o_nonblock_inherited to site/common-linux
When compiling apr for no-powerpc arch, the flag ac_cv_o_nonblock_inherited
is always set to yes in cross compiling environment. This flag is intended to
think the socket, returned from accept(), inherit file status flags such as
O_NONBLOCK from the listening socket, but socket never inherits file status
from the listening socket on Linux (more information to man accept).

This is Linux-wide behaviour, so move it from meta/site/powerpc32-linux
to site/common-linux.

If ac_cv_o_nonblock_inherited is set to yes on Linux, clients can not access the
same ip address(URL) with Apache web server via http(port 80) and https(port443)
without redirection
